Job Summary
As an Electrical Design Engineer at FERCHAU, you will be responsible for taking technology solutions to the next level by designing electrical systems specifically for control cabinet construction. Your daily activities will involve developing detailed solution concepts, creating comprehensive manufacturing and customer documentation using EPLAN, and actively participating in the physical implementation within the production process.
